Output 58c76d21691276f18f1252e7836ed1eb01df941ad8f6701bbe391c29bfde3ee7:2
- value
- 32189511
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ba196d6265bf49fb74434980d404b7f9a6b9544e OP_EQUAL
- address
- 3Jf24wdnHzhnZNVVEP3uuesJAX27aXhVYG
- transaction
- 58c76d21691276f18f1252e7836ed1eb01df941ad8f6701bbe391c29bfde3ee7
- spent
- true